Facebook Live: The First Day of Being a Widow
On today’s episode, Lisa Joy discusses the reality of the day after her husband’s death. On part two, she shares how the musical “Rent” had an impact on her husband’s memorial service. She learned that it’s the seasons of love that make life worth living, for love is eternal. The two parts of this episode are previously recorded from a Facebook Live on the Widow Walking Forward Facebook page in 2018.
